BALLISTICS

Rifle Scope

Ballistics is the science of projectile motion, covering the processes inside a firearm, the projectile's flight after leaving the barrel, and its impact on a target.   This PROJECTILE or bullet is the piece of coated lead that leaves the barrel after firing.  The CARTRIDGE is the brass case, primer, powder and projectile all together.  The BALLISTICS of the bullet is a complex set of calculations based on many factors including the weight and shape of the projectile, the velocity of the bullet, which is mostly determined by the amount and type of powder used in the cartridge, and even your barrel length, just to name a few. 

 

You will learn that every projectile has a BALLISTIC COEFFICIENT (BC) which is an indication of how efficiently it flies, and how well it maintains its velocity when wind and gravity are working against it.
